How to Verify Postcss Import's Safety Yourself
While Nerq provides automated trust analysis, we recommend these additional steps before adopting any software tool:
- Check the source code — Bekijk de repository beveiliging policy, open issues, and recent commits for signs of active onderhoud.
- Scan dependencies — Use tools like
npm audit,pip-audit, orsnykto check for known vulnerabilities in Postcss Import's dependency tree. - Beoordeling permissions — Understand what access Postcss Import requires. Software tools should follow the principle of least privilege.
- Test in isolation — Run Postcss Import in a sandboxed environment before granting access to production data or systems.
- Monitor continuously — Use Nerq's API to set up automated trust checks:
GET nerq.ai/v1/preflight?target=postcss-import - Bekijk de license — Confirm that Postcss Import's license is compatible with your intended use case. Pay attention to restrictions on commercial use, redistribution, and derivative works. Some AI tools use dual licensing or have separate terms for enterprise customers that differ from the open-source license.
- Check community signals — Look at the project's issue tracker, discussion forums, and social media presence. A healthy community actively reports bugs, contributes fixes, and discusses beveiliging concerns openly. Low community engagement may indicate limited peer review of the codebase.
